Forskolin-induced cyclic AMP production and gastric acid secretion in dispersed rabbit parietal cells: Novel evidence for a major role of cyclic AMP in acid release

1983 
Abstract Forskolin, a unique diterpine which is a direct activator of cyclic AMP-generating systems, stimulated both cyclic AMP and acid production in dispersed rabbit parietal cells. This agent was also capable of augmenting the action of histamine on both cyclic AMP and acid production at a low concentration. These findings provided novel evidence for a major role of cyclic AMP in gastric acid secretion.
